4 hours agoA heart warming tale about a 13 yr old witch who has to go live in a city for a year to learn new skills and magic. And we are treated to see how she makes new friends, finds a job and struggles with balancing work and a social life. Lots of subtle moments within the stories that give a really enriching experience and depth to characters. One of the best studio gibli stories. Everyone should give it a go! Brilliant for all ages!
